Cut the Cereal Sugar

What kid doesn’t love cereal?!?  If you are a mom trying to minimize the amount of added sugar your child consumes, finding a cereal that they like can be VERY difficult!  Plain old Cheerios are are great option as they only have 1 gram or sugar.  My kids haven’t eaten plain old Cheerios since they were toddlers. However, they will eat Multi-Grain Cheerios without complaints.  Multi-Grain Cheerios are a fairly low sugar cereal as they only have 6 grams of sugar per serving.

To further reduce the amount of added sugar in their diet I have started mixing the two.  I bought a cereal container and mix the two in it when my kids aren’t around.  I don’t think they have any idea.  I can get away with about 1/3 Multi-Grain and 2/3 Plain Cheerios.
